Fibrillin-Related Proteins Control Calcium Homeostasis in Dystrophic Muscle Across Species

GSE299627 Homo sapiens Expression profiling by high throughput sequencing 6 samples Submitted 2025/09/01 Platform GPL34284
Summary
Duchenne muscular dystrophy (DMD) involves progressive muscle degeneration associated with calcium dysregulation, but the mechanisms linking extracellular matrix (ECM) integrity to calcium homeostasis remain unclear. We investigated whether MUA-3, a fibrillin-related ECM protein in Caenorhabditis elegans, contributes to calcium regulation in dystrophic muscle. Using fluorescent calcium imaging in transgenic worms expressing muscle-specific GCaMP2, we found that downregulating mua-3 selectively elevated resting calcium levels in healthy muscle but had no effect in dystrophic (dys-1) muscle, suggesting impaired MUA-3 function in dystrophy. Despite altered calcium dynamics, mua-3 downregulation did not affect locomotor function. In human dystrophic myoblasts, we observed significantly elevated sarcoplasmic calcium levels concurrent with substantial downregulation of fibrillin genes FBN1/FBN2. These findings demonstrate that fibrillin-related proteins regulate calcium homeostasis across species, suggesting that ECM integrity directly contributes to cellular calcium control in muscle. This work identifies a conserved mechanism linking extracellular matrix stability to intracellular calcium regulation and suggests that targeting ECM-calcium coupling may offer new therapeutic approaches for muscular dystrophy.
